Abstract:

The present study aims to determine the effect of in-service training courses in neonatal c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R) on the rate of successful resuscitation in nurses working in the neonatal department. This quasi-experimental study was conducted among nurses employed in the neonatal department at the Sayad Shirazi Hospital in Gorgan, Golestan province, Iran. The in-service training course for neonatal CPR was conducted in two separate groups across consecutive days, following the latest Heart Association guidelines. Subsequently, an evaluation was conducted across four levels: knowledge, learning, behavior, and performance. After calculating the coefficients for each level, the resulting figures were compared with the successful rehabilitation index. A total of ۳۰ nurses were participants in the research. In the initial level, nurses' satisfaction with the course conditions significantly increased from ۵۶.۲۶ to ۹۳.۷۶ out of ۱۰۰ points post-intervention (P<۰.۰۱) as per the paired t-test. Moving to the second level, there was a substantial improvement in learning scores, rising from ۱۳.۱۲ (SD=۲.۸۲) before the intervention to ۱۶.۳۲ (SD=۲.۲۱) after (P<۰.۰۱). At the third level, behavior scores increased from ۳۲.۱۹ to ۴۷.۸۰ after accounting for a factor of ۳, showing significant improvement (P<۰.۰۱). For the fourth level, the successful resuscitation rate increased from ۵۰% to a calculated score of ۲۰۰.۲ after applying a coefficient of ۴ (P<۰.۰۱). Combining these levels and considering coefficients, the overall effectiveness of the course was calculated at ۶۹.۸۶%. In sum, the study revealed suboptimal effectiveness in the newborn CPR training course. Consequently, nursing education system managers and practitioners should delve into the impediments and factors influencing this course.
